155 FGUS84 KCRP 041813 RVSCRP TXC469-050915- Hydrologic Statement National Weather Service Corpus Christi TX 1213 PM CST Sun Feb 4 2024 ...Notable but below river flood levels expected on the Coleto Creek... For the Coleto Creek at Highway 59, Victoria. * At 11:30 AM CST Sunday the stage was 15.6 feet. * Flood stage is 25.0 feet. * Bankfull stage is 15.0 feet. * Caution stage is 15.0 feet. * Forecast: The creek will remain nearly steady around the caution stage, between 15.0-16.0 feet through the next few days.
